- 艾寶物聯(lián)IOBOV? ─ 工業(yè)無線測控專家
一些任務是間歇性的,但他們需要知道操作的最后狀態(tài)。這是一種典型的操作。要記住的是,什么構成一個模式?程序是怎樣分配使得它滿足兩個要求?使用ALT指令能處理一種簡單的這個/那個的情況。
這種編程形式在很多情況中可以見到。不過經常地,使用都略有不同。在某一場合中,一臺機器可能被起動;在另一場合中,一個排氣扇可能在循環(huán)與排氣間轉換。不同情況下,問題的初始表現(xiàn)并不能讓人想起相同的解決方法。
對于本節(jié)的例子黑板擦來說,也是奴此。編程者的初始反應是它與起動一臺機器或改變一個模式不一樣。然而,如果忽略實際應用,只研究對象運行所要求的事件或序列,那么在這些不同的應用中能提取出相似之處。
這個目的不能獨立地達到,因為實際問題確實訪礙某些理想操作的發(fā)生。要記住的是,觀察一個問題的方法不止一種,這個非常短小精悍的擦黑板程序就是其中一種方法。